"A frat house on wheels," "Touch a button and in 30 seconds the roof, accessed by a spiral staircase from inside, transforms into an observation deck complete with stereo, umbrellas, cooler and grill. Its interior is loaded with the amenities..." (AutoWeek)
Airstream's SkyDeck is the only motor home currently manufactured that has it's own roof-top deck. While adding only 10 inches to the overall height over that of a standard coach, the deck essentially doubles its usable space, at least, in good
weather. With plenty of seating, tables, and amenities such as wet bar, barbeque, and entertainment center, there is room up top for up to 15 people.
Cost? The MSRP starts at about $280,000 before extras are added (little things like options, shipping, taxes, etc.) This one is just a bit out of my league.
